Output 54d84a9157cabefa638539bcc9014de5f8142948c740dcc8249129fe0c4e5ff5:27

value
1879839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e44774267f431bb347eb78e680d1634f4be0f2c OP_EQUAL
address
37NFqXbjbvr817pFVV7xB8Gko6Ct1a8D1P
transaction
54d84a9157cabefa638539bcc9014de5f8142948c740dcc8249129fe0c4e5ff5
spent
true